Achieving Maximum Recovery Through Balanced Macronutrient Consumption

Upon finishing a grueling ultrarun, the body demands the right fuel for effective recovery. Attaining a balance of macronutrients—comprising proteins, carbohydrates, and fats—is crucial for restoring energy levels and effectively repairing muscles. Proteins are essential for muscle synthesis; therefore, athletes should focus on high-quality sources like lean meats, dairy products, quinoa, and legumes. Consuming protein shortly after exercise is vital for promoting muscle repair and growth, ultimately leading to better performance in subsequent workouts.

Carbohydrates are equally crucial, as they are responsible for replenishing the glycogen stores that become depleted during intense running. It is imperative to focus on complex carbohydrates found in whole grains, fruits, and vegetables. Consuming carbohydrates alongside protein in a 3:1 ratio can maximize glycogen recovery, ensuring that athletes have the energy needed for their next training endeavor. This careful balance of macronutrients is vital for ultrarunners seeking to enhance recovery and improve performance outcomes.

Healthy fats, often overlooked in favor of proteins and carbohydrates, also play a significant role in supporting overall health and combating inflammation. Including sources like avocados, nuts, and olive oil provides essential fatty acids that contribute to recovery. By understanding the balance of these macronutrients, ultrarunners can optimize their dietary strategies to support effective recovery and elevate their long-term athletic performance.

The Essential Role of Hydration and Electrolyte Replacement in Recovery

Hydration remains paramount for ultrarunners, particularly after long-distance events where substantial fluid loss occurs. Dehydration can lead to a decline in physical performance and prolong recovery times. Athletes should strive to replenish fluids lost through sweat, making electrolyte drinks essential for efficient recovery.

Electrolytes, including sodium, potassium, and magnesium, are vital for muscle function and hydration. Consuming electrolyte-rich beverages after a run can help restore balance and effectively support recovery. Natural sources, such as coconut water or sports drinks with minimal additives, provide hydration without excessive sugars. This focused approach to hydration is crucial for maintaining optimal athletic performance.

Incorporating hydration strategies into recovery routines can significantly enhance overall performance and mitigate the risks associated with dehydration. Monitoring fluid intake and adjusting based on individual sweat rates is essential for optimal recovery outcomes, ensuring that ultrarunners are fully prepared for future challenges and competitions.

Timing Nutrient Intake for Maximum Recovery Benefits

The timing of nutrient intake can greatly influence recovery outcomes for ultrarunners. Consuming a balanced meal or snack shortly after completing a long run is essential for facilitating muscle repair and replenishing glycogen stores. The “anabolic window,” which occurs within 30 minutes post-exercise, is when the body is most receptive to nutrients, making it imperative for athletes to capitalize on this crucial period.

During this vital time, athletes should focus on consuming a mix of carbohydrates and proteins to maximize recovery benefits. For instance, a smoothie made with protein powder, banana, and almond milk can provide the necessary nutrients for effective recovery. This targeted approach ensures that the body receives optimal support during the recovery phase.

In addition to immediate post-run nutrition, maintaining a consistent meal schedule over the next 24-48 hours is crucial. This sustained focus on nutrition ensures that the body has the necessary resources for ongoing recovery and performance enhancement, establishing a solid foundation for success in subsequent training and competitive events.

Enhancing Recovery with Massage and Foam Rolling Techniques

Massage and foam rolling techniques are remarkably effective for self-myofascial release, significantly decreasing muscle soreness and enhancing flexibility. Regular massages help relieve tension and promote relaxation, thereby enriching overall recovery and well-being. Professional massages can be particularly beneficial following long races, as they specifically target muscle groups that endure the most stress, aiding in the recovery process.

Foam rolling is a self-administered technique that is accessible and can be performed in various settings, making it an ideal recovery tool for ultrarunners. By applying pressure to tight areas, foam rolling helps break down knots and improve blood flow. Research suggests that foam rolling can enhance range of motion and decrease the severity of delayed onset muscle soreness (DOMS), establishing it as an essential practice in recovery.

Establishing a routine that incorporates both massage and foam rolling can dramatically improve recovery times and overall performance. Athletes should contemplate integrating foam rollers and seeking professional massage therapy as crucial components of their post-run recovery strategy to maximize their recovery potential.

The Importance of Protein Supplements for Effective Muscle Recovery

Protein supplements are invaluable for ultrarunners focused on muscle recovery and growth. Following a run, the body requires protein to initiate the repair and rebuilding of muscle fibers, making the type and timing of protein intake crucial for effective recovery. Various protein powders, including whey, casein, and plant-based options, are available to accommodate individual dietary preferences and requirements.

Whey protein, known for its rapid absorption, is ideal for post-exercise recovery. In contrast, casein digests more slowly, providing a sustained release of amino acids to support muscle repair and recovery. Plant-based proteins, such as pea and rice protein, cater to those following vegan diets while still delivering adequate recovery benefits. This variety ensures that all athletes can find a protein source that aligns with their dietary needs and preferences.

Incorporating protein supplements into a recovery plan can significantly enhance muscle rebuilding and reduce recovery time. Athletes should experiment with different types of protein supplements to discover what works best for their bodies and unique recovery needs, ensuring they remain at the forefront of their performance.

Replenishing Electrolytes for Enhanced Recovery Results

Electrolytes are critical to the recovery process for ultrarunners, particularly after extended races where significant fluid and electrolyte loss occurs. Key electrolytes such as sodium, potassium, magnesium, and calcium are essential for maintaining hydration and muscle function during recovery, making their replenishment vital.

Incorporating electrolyte-rich drinks or natural sources, like coconut water, can effectively restore lost electrolytes. Additionally, consuming whole foods rich in electrolytes, such as bananas (for potassium) and dairy products (for calcium), supports recovery efforts and helps prevent imbalances that can impair performance.

Monitoring electrolyte levels and ensuring proper replenishment is crucial for ultrarunners, particularly in hot climates or during extended races. A thoughtful approach to hydration and electrolyte intake can greatly improve recovery outcomes and overall performance, prepping athletes for their next challenge.
